TBLEG
扫描微信账号

扫一扫微信二维码

SPL笔记之双向链表

2020-05-16 信息
区块链白皮书代写

SplDoublyLinkedList

    rewind:使链表当前指针指向链表底部(bottom)

    push:向链表顶部(尾部)插入一个节点

    pop:获取链表中顶部(尾部)节点,并且从链表中删除这个节点;操作不改变当前指针位置

    current:指向链表当前节点指针,必须在调用之前先调用rewind。当指向节点被删除之后,会指向一个空节点。

    next:让链表当前节点指针指向下一个节点,current返回值随之改变

    unshift:向链表底部(头部)插入一个节点

    shift:删除一个链表底部(头部)节点

    bottom:获取链表底部(头部)元素,当前指针位置不变

    top:获取链表顶部(尾部)元素,当前指针位置不变

全文阅读
文章关键词
cto
Blog
扫描关注微信账号

试试长按二维码加关注